Описание тега connectivitymanager
0
ответов
ConnectivityManager.requestNetwork() не работает должным образом
Я пытаюсь временно заставить устройство использовать мобильные данные. я использую ConnectivityManager.requestNetwork(), NetworkRequest.Builder request = new NetworkRequest.Builder(); request.addCapability(NetworkCapabilities.NET_CAPABILITY_INTERNET…
09 апр '18 в 18:01
1
ответ
Есть ли способ проверить, подключен ли Ethernet специально (даже если WIFI также подключен)?
С помощью диспетчера соединений достаточно просто увидеть, есть ли соединение, однако, если одновременно подключены и Ethernet, и WIFI, всегда отображается сообщение о подключении WIFI. Я хочу знать, есть ли у меня связь, но также и то, что конкретн…
08 мар '18 в 03:40
0
ответов
connectivityManager.startUsingNetworkFeature & connectivityManager.requestRouteToHost выдает ошибку для API-уровня 26
Я использовал ниже два метода для уровня API < 26, но для уровня API> 26 это дает ошибку, может кто-нибудь помочь, как исправить ниже кусков. Заранее спасибо. connectivityManager.startUsingNetworkFeature //activate mobile connection in addition to o…
04 окт '17 в 08:30
2
ответа
Правильный способ проверить, если Wi-Fi подключен в Android
Для моего приложения я должен убедиться, что пользователь подключен к Wi-Fi, прежде чем связаться с сервером. Я нашел два способа сделать это, но я не уверен, достаточно ли одного. Сначала я добавляю это: WifiManager wifiManager = (WifiManager) getA…
19 мар '17 в 14:39
2
ответа
Как позвонить по приему от по приему другого BroadcastReceiver в Android?
Я занимаюсь разработкой одного приложения для Android, в котором мне нужно вызвать метод AlarmReager onReceive из onReceive другого BroadcastReceiver, то есть подключения к Интернету. Является ли это возможным? Или я должен дублировать все свои вещи…
26 ноя '16 в 07:26
0
ответов
ConnectivityManager.NetworkCallback никогда не получает доступный обратный вызов
Я пытаюсь форсировать сетевой запрос через сотовую сеть. Для этого я запрашиваю обратный вызов мобильной сети из ConnectivityManager, например так: private static final String LOG_TAG = "Main"; @Override protected void onCreate(Bundle savedInstanceS…
08 ноя '17 в 18:19
1
ответ
Можно ли получить тип сети (Wi-Fi/ мобильный), не требуя разрешений?
Мне нужно знать тип сети, но для этого требуются разрешения. Я пытаюсь так: public String getConnectionTypeNew(Context context){ ConnectivityManager cm = (ConnectivityManager) context.get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o activ…
04 окт '16 в 21:05
1
ответ
Отправка трафика в Android-приложении через определенное соединение
Я занимаюсь разработкой приложения для Android, в котором мне нужно установить HTTP-соединение только через WiFi. Кажется, было много изменений, связанных с подключением в Android L и выше. Это кусок кода, который я использую: ConnectivityManager ma…
16 дек '16 в 17:27
2
ответа
Как вызвать метод внешней активности из адаптера?
Я пытаюсь вызвать метод внешнего класса из адаптера как new MainActivity().openPainRecordDialog(context,dbHelper); это работает нормально. Но когда я так делаю Boolean status=new MainActivity().openPainRecordDialog(context,dbHelper); if(status) chec…
07 дек '16 в 13:34
1
ответ
Как проверить, находится ли устройство в состоянии подключения при подключении к Wi-Fi или мобильным данным?
Я занимаюсь разработкой приложения для Android, которое запускает мой веб-сервис при запуске приложения. Мое приложение в основном домашнее приложение устройства. То есть, когда пользователь перезагрузит устройство, Мое приложение появится перед ним…
25 окт '18 в 11:08
1
ответ
WifiManager enableNetwork возвращается к предыдущей сети через несколько секунд
На Android 8.1.0 и выше я сталкиваюсь с серьезной проблемой. При подключении к сети без интернета с помощью enableNetworkAndroid решает вернуть устройство в предыдущую сеть через несколько секунд. Я намеренно подключился к желаемой сети и планирую и…
18 окт '18 в 17:45
2
ответа
Проверка онлайн соединения всегда возвращает True
У меня в основной деятельности настроен динамический широковещательный приемник, который должен отображать сообщение Toast при каждом изменении состояния сети. Я подключаюсь онлайн, запускаю приложение "Вы в сети!" Появится сообщение с тостами, зате…
19 фев '17 в 11:48
2
ответа
Получать уведомления только когда данные или Wi-Fi отключен
Здравствуйте, ребята, я создаю приложение, в котором я хочу уведомлять пользователя только тогда, когда устройство теряет соединение, будь то мобильные данные или Wi-Fi. До сих пор я использовал этот метод: private void setupReceiver() { CheckNetwor…
23 ноя '16 в 09:46
0
ответов
Используйте интернет из сотовой сети, когда Wi-Fi включен и подключен
В моем случае Wi-Fi всегда будет включен и подключен к определенному SSID. Но я хочу использовать интернет из сотовой сети (3G/4G), оставляя Wi-Fi включенным. Я попытался connection_manager.bindProcessToNetwork(сеть); но это заставляет приложение ис…
03 июн '18 в 09:49
2
ответа
Как обрабатывать com.android.volley.NoConnectionError: java.net.UnknownHostException
Я использую Volley для веб-звонков в своем приложении, и все работает нормально и гладко, за исключением одного состояния, в котором мое устройство каким-то образом не получает сетевое соединение, но проверка соединения через код возвращает значение…
20 окт '16 в 04:25
2
ответа
ConnectivityManager connMgr = (ConnectivityManager) getContext(). GetSystemService возвращает ноль при загрузке
Я получаю ошибку в ConnectivityManager при загрузке приложения. Я использовал это много, но я впервые сталкиваюсь с этим. это говорит о нуле, но я понятия не имею, что вызывает эта ошибка. это мой код: final ConnectivityManager connMgr = (Connectivi…
16 июл '18 в 01:46
4
ответа
Android getActiveNetwork всегда возвращает ноль
Я занимаюсь разработкой приложения Tango с Unity и Tango SDK, однако мне нужно иметь возможность проверять подключение Wi-Fi устройства и подключаться к сети Wi-Fi соответственно. Имея это в виду, я начал работать над сетевым плагином Android Unity,…
09 авг '17 в 03:35
2
ответа
Если мобильные данные включены и Wi-Fi также включен, но не имеет данных. то как отправить запрос по WIFI
Используйте этот код, если вы хотите использовать только Wi-Fi. Пожалуйста, убедитесь, что версия для Android должна быть больше 21. @RequiresApi(api = Build.VERSION_CODES.LOLLIPOP) public static void stayOnWifi(Context context) { final Connectivity…
08 ноя '17 в 05:18
1
ответ
Как получить WIFI SSID в Android 9.0(PIE)?
Как получить WIFI SSID в Android 9.0(PIE)? Мой код работает нормально до Android 8.1.0, но он не работает на Android 9.0 ConnectivityManager connManager = (ConnectivityManager) activity.get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o net…
26 окт '18 в 09:35
2
ответа
Как проверить медленное подключение к сети в Android
Я должен показать страницу, если подключение к сети медленное я проверяю сеть с помощью этого кода ConnectivityManager cm = (ConnectivityManager) context.get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o info = cm.getActiveNetworkInfo(); i…
13 июн '17 в 10:09